INEOS Oligomers to build PAO plant in Texas
12/14/2017 8:55:57 PM
Today, INEOS Oligomers announced it had made the Final Investment Decision (FID) to build a new world scale, low viscosity Polyalphaolefin (PAO) unit on the INEOS site at Chocolate Bayou, TX.
This unit will have a capacity of 120 Mmtpy and become the world’s largest single PAO train. The plant is scheduled to start-up in 3Q 2019.
The new PAO unit will obtain its feedstock from the adjacent Linear Alpha Olefin (LAO) plant, which is currently under construction at the same site. This investment represents a major step forward in the ambitious growth plans for the INEOS Oligomers PAO business, complementing existing units in La Porte, TX and Feluy, Belgium.
